I have just updated today 2 August 2019. I cannot say if it this latest update that has caused the following problem or not.
It is not possible to upload large files to the server using the Filemanager. I have tried logged in as Admin with root access. It is not possible to upload files (around 80MB), using the drag and drop interface of directory selection. Does not work using the Basic File manager either. (Wanting to upload cPanel migration files).
It is also not possible to upload files when logged in as an CWP user.
I have tried with small files (approx 30kB) and this works. The problem seems to be with larger files.

I have increased max_post_size and upload_max_filesize both to 512M
I have checked that this is reflected in PHP Settings >> PHP Info and it is, but still the upload fails for big files (e.g. 70MB).
It would be logical that that the FileManager might have a different php.ini file with large file sizes by default, so that it is not restrained by normal file size limits that might apply elsewhere. I think this might be what is happening and so adjusting the normal php.ini is not resolving the issue. I just don't know where this alternative php.ini file is.

edit
/usr/local/cwp/php71/php.ini
post_max_size = 512M
upload_max_filesize = 512M
memory_limit = 256M
edit
/usr/local/cwpsrv/conf/cwpsrv.conf
client_max_body_size 512M
service cwp-phpfpm restart
service cwpsrv restart
